ISyncr syncs your iTunes library from a PC or Mac including: iTunes playlists, music, podcasts, videos (non-DRM) and more. Sync iTunes song information including: album art, ratings, play count, last played, last skipped and more. Sync iTunes content to the internal or SD card storage, over USB/MTP or WiFi. ISyncr will not sync iTunes copy protected content but will alert you to DRM content. iTunes for Windows
Looking for Windows 32-bit? Download here
Hardware:
- PC with a 1GHz Intel or AMD processor with support for SSE2 and 512MB of RAM
- To play standard-definition video from the iTunes Store, an Intel Pentium D or faster processor, 512MB of RAM, and a DirectX 9.0–compatible video card is required
- To play 720p HD video, an iTunes LP, or iTunes Extras, a 2.0GHz Intel Core 2 Duo or faster processor, 1GB of RAM, and an Intel GMA X3000, ATI Radeon X1300, or NVIDIA GeForce 6150 or better is required
- To play 1080p HD video, a 2.4GHz Intel Core 2 Duo or faster processor, 2GB of RAM, and an Intel GMA X4500HD, ATI Radeon HD 2400, or NVIDIA GeForce 8300 GS or better is required
- Screen resolution of 1024x768 or greater; 1280x800 or greater is required to play an iTunes LP or iTunes Extras
- 16-bit sound card and speakers
- Internet connection to use the iTunes Store and iTunes Extras
- iTunes-compatible CD or DVD recorder to create audio CDs, MP3 CDs, or backup CDs or DVDs.
Software:
- Windows 7 or later
- 64-bit editions of Windows require the iTunes 64-bit installer
- 400MB of available disk space
- Some third-party visualizers may no longer be compatible with this version of iTunes. Please contact the developer for an updated visualizer that is compatible with iTunes 12.1 or later.
- Apple Music, iTunes Store, and iTunes Match availability may vary by country

Use iTunes U to view or download educational materials, including free lectures, videos, books, and other resources on thousands of subjects. You can access iTunes U content through the iTunes application on your computer or through a provided iTunes U link.
All Mac OS X computers come with iTunes installed.These instructions were developed using iTunes 11.1 (v.11.1.5) on a Mac OS X Lion (10.7.5). Steps may vary for other Macintosh operating systems.
Access iTunes U through iTunes
- In Finder, go to Applications > iTunes. Note: Make sure you have the latest version of iTunes. Your computer will prompt you to update to the latest version if necessary.
- Double-click iTunes. iTunes will open.
- In the top right corner, click iTunes Store. The iTunes Store will open. Note: Make sure you are connected to the Internet.
- In the iTunes Store top menu bar, click iTunes U (at right). The iTunes U home page will open.
(Optional) Click the small arrow next to iTunes U for a drop-down menu with quick links for different iTunes U materials (e,g., Arts & Architecture, Business). - In iTunes U, use the navigation at right, the search function (top right) or the main page shortcuts to locate courses and collections.
- On a course or collection home page, you can access individual lectures, podcasts, and related documents, share files, and subscribe to course updates.
- Click the price of an item (e.g., Free) to download it to your iTunes Library and access it without Internet connectivity.
- Some materials may only be available on iOS devices.
- To get the URL of an individual lecture or podcast, in the Price column, click the arrow, then select Copy Link. Paste the link in an email message or a document.
